Team Upgrades:

Bronze 1-20=94,600
Silver 21-40=312,500
Gold 41-60=1,075,000
Platinum 61-80= 3,170,000
Diamond 81-84=2.1 mill***(needs to be confirmed)
Diamond 85-100=49.5k gold, when discounted

Expected Value of:
Legend Improve boxes=1.57
Legend XP boxes=3.14
Mega LXP boxes=5.06
Mega Pxp=7.59

Example: A legend xp box, which costs 300 gold, will yield about 900 lxp on average.

Using the multipliers below, you can compute any ratings at level 10 for any tier:

Silver-1.61
Gold-2.14
Platinum-2.82
Diamond-3.66

Example: A rating of 112/110 at bronze 1 would  be 410/403 at diamond 10.

    Here is a helpful chart I made some time ago:

    (It's kinda obselete now but better than nothing)

    Below are appropriate XP values for base players who are traded in. Note that this applies to bronze 1 players only. Because a player of a certain star rating varies insignificantly (i.e. base 5 stars can be as high as 82 over or as low as 72) the xp/person of a certain star will vary, albeit insignificant. Therefore, each approximation should be given a +/- 5% variability. 

    1 star - 11 XP
    1.5 star - 17 XP
    2 star - 29 XP
    2.5 star - 75 XP
    3 star - 201 XP
    3.5 star - 518 XP
    4 star - 693 XP 
    4.5 star - 938 XP
     5 star - 1400 XP

    Note that these are weighted averages. If you open one late round draft pick you could get 9 XP or more than 200 XP. However, as the odds pan out over a long period of opening picks, the average XP per pick will approach the average listed below.

    Late round draft pick
    1% at 201
    9% at 75
    30% at 29
    30% at 17
    30% at 11
    Weighted average - 25.86 XP

    Second round draft pick
    2% at 693
    3.5% at 518
    5% at 201
    26.5% at 75
    29% at 29
    34% at 17
    Weighted average - 76.105 XP

    First round draft pick
    .5% at 1400
    2% at 938
    5% at 693
    10% at 518
    14.5% at 201
    30% at 75
    38% at 29
    Weighted average - 174.875 XP 

    #1 overall draft pick
    2.5% at 1400
    7.5% at 938
    25% at 693
    30% at 518
    35% at 201
    Weighted average - 504.35 XP
